The larger the home windows, the even more effort and time it will certainly take to remove the color. This implies that larger windows will usually have a higher removal cost compared to smaller home windows. Mid-size cars generally fall within the rate range of $100 to $200 for home window tint removal. The somewhat larger home windows may Quality Car Tinting Sacramento raise the time and effort needed for elimination, resulting in a higher expense compared to little vehicles. For small cars and trucks, the average expense variety for home window color removal is normally in between $50 and $150.

The lifespan of a household home window film can differ depending on the top quality of the film, the type of adhesive made use of, and the quantity of straight sunshine that the window gets. Top notch home window movies can last between 5 to 15 years, while lower-quality movies may last just a few years.
